What element is the crown chakra? This question often puzzles those delving into the world of yoga, meditation, and spirituality. The crown chakra, known as “Sahasrara” in Sanskrit, is the seventh and final chakra in the body’s energy system. It is located at the top of the head and is associated with the element of air. Understanding the element connected to each chakra is crucial in balancing the body’s energy and promoting overall well-being.

The crown chakra, governed by the element of air, represents the realm of thoughts, ideas, and spiritual connection. It is the chakra that connects us to the universe and allows us to experience a sense of oneness with all existence. The element of air is the essence of movement, change, and the unseen. It symbolizes our ability to communicate, perceive, and understand the world around us.

Air is a subtle element that governs our intellectual and spiritual growth. The crown chakra is responsible for our intuition, wisdom, and the pursuit of higher knowledge. When this chakra is balanced, we experience clarity of thought, open-mindedness, and a deep sense of connection to the divine. However, when it is blocked or imbalanced, we may experience confusion, a lack of purpose, and a sense of disconnection from the world.
